Free Image Resizer - Resize Images to Any Dimensions Online
Resize photos and images to custom dimensions or social media sizes. Maintain aspect ratio, batch resize multiple images, perfect for web and social.
What is Image Resizer?
Our Image Resizer makes it effortless to resize photos and images to exact dimensions. Whether you need specific pixel dimensions for your website, social media size presets (Instagram, Facebook, Twitter), or custom aspect ratios, our tool handles it all with precision and speed.
The tool automatically maintains aspect ratio by default, preventing distorted images when you resize. You can lock width or height and let the other dimension adjust proportionally, or manually set both dimensions for exact control. Social media presets ensure your images meet platform requirements - Instagram posts (1080×1080px), story (1080×1920px), Facebook covers (820×312px), Twitter headers (1500×500px), and more.
Batch resizing powers through multiple images at once, applying the same dimensions to entire folders. Perfect for photographers resizing galleries, designers preparing assets at multiple sizes, or anyone optimizing images for web use. Preview before downloading to ensure perfect results.
All image processing happens locally in your browser using HTML5 Canvas. Your photos never upload to servers, ensuring complete privacy for personal photos, client work, or confidential images. Works with JPG, PNG, WebP, and GIF formats.
Powerful Features
Everything you need in one amazing tool
Custom Dimensions
Set exact width and height in pixels. Perfect pixel precision for any use case.
Maintain Aspect Ratio
Automatically preserve proportions. No stretched or distorted images.
Social Media Presets
One-click presets for Instagram, Facebook, Twitter, LinkedIn. Optimized for each platform.
Batch Resize
Resize multiple images at once. Apply same dimensions to entire folders.
Percentage Scaling
Scale by percentage (50%, 200%). Enlarge or reduce by proportion.
Live Preview
See results before downloading. Preview resized dimensions and file size.
How It Works
Get started in 4 easy steps
Upload Images
Drag and drop or select images. Supports JPG, PNG, WebP, GIF.
Set Dimensions
Enter custom width/height or choose social media preset. Lock aspect ratio if needed.
Preview Results
See resized image preview. Check dimensions and file size before downloading.
Download
Download single image or batch download all as ZIP. Original format preserved.
Why Choose Our Image Resizer?
Stand out from the competition
Instant Resizing
Resize images in seconds. Process entire batches quickly.
Smart Scaling
Advanced algorithms preserve image quality when scaling up or down.
Unlimited Use
Resize unlimited images. No file size or quantity limits.
100% Private
All processing local. Photos never uploaded. Safe for personal/confidential images.
Flexible Options
Pixels, percentage, aspect ratios, presets. Resize exactly how you need.
Quality Preserved
Smart resampling maintains clarity. No pixelation or artifacts.
Perfect For
See how others are using this tool
Social Media Posts
Resize for Instagram, Facebook, Twitter, LinkedIn. Meet platform size requirements.
Website Optimization
Create responsive image sizes. Optimize for desktop, tablet, mobile breakpoints.
Profile Pictures
Resize headshots for profiles. Perfect dimensions for avatars and profile photos.
Email Attachments
Reduce image size for email. Stay under attachment limits without compression.
Photography Portfolios
Resize galleries consistently. Create thumbnail and full-size versions.
E-commerce Products
Standardize product images. Consistent sizing across entire catalog.
Frequently Asked Questions
Everything you need to know about Image Resizer
Resizing changes the overall dimensions while keeping the entire image visible - it scales the whole image proportionally smaller or larger. Cropping cuts away parts of the image to keep only a specific area, changing composition but not necessarily the scale. Example: resizing a 4000×3000px photo to 1000×750px makes everything smaller but keeps all content. Cropping that same photo to 1000×1000px removes sides to fit a square. Use resizing when you want to keep all content but change size. Use cropping when you need to change aspect ratio or focus on specific parts.
Resizing DOWN (making smaller) typically maintains excellent quality - you're removing pixels but retaining detail. Resizing UP (making larger/enlarging) can reduce quality because you're creating new pixels through interpolation, which can cause blurriness. Our tool uses bicubic resampling, the highest-quality scaling algorithm, minimizing quality loss. Best practices: always keep original high-resolution versions, resize down not up when possible, avoid repeated resizing (resize once from original), and for web use, slight quality reduction from resizing down is imperceptible but saves significant file size.
Instagram: Posts 1080×1080px (square) or 1080×1350px (portrait), Stories 1080×1920px, Reels 1080×1920px. Facebook: Posts 1200×630px, Cover Photo 820×312px, Story 1080×1920px. Twitter: Posts 1200×675px, Header 1500×500px. LinkedIn: Posts 1200×627px, Cover Photo 1584×396px, Profile Photo 400×400px. YouTube: Thumbnail 1280×720px, Channel Art 2560×1440px. Pinterest: Pins 1000×1500px (2:3 ratio). These dimensions ensure maximum quality without platform compression. Always use highest recommended dimensions and let platform scale down for different devices.
Absolutely YES! This is one of the most important website optimization steps. Never upload original camera/phone photos (often 4000×3000px, 5-10MB) directly to websites. Resize images to actual display dimensions: hero images 1920×1080px, blog post images 1200×800px, thumbnails 400×300px, product photos 800×800px. This dramatically improves page load speed (Google ranking factor), reduces bandwidth costs, and improves mobile user experience. Even if CSS displays images smaller, browsers still download full-size files. Tools like our resizer + compressor can reduce images from 5MB to 200KB with zero visible quality loss. Aim for web images under 200KB each.
Yes! Our tool maintains aspect ratio by default. When you enter width, height auto-calculates proportionally (or vice versa). Lock aspect ratio to prevent distortion - original 4:3 images stay 4:3, 16:9 stays 16:9. To change aspect ratio: either crop first then resize, or manually set both dimensions knowing the image will stretch/squeeze. For social media, first crop to target aspect ratio (1:1 for Instagram square, 16:9 for YouTube), then resize to exact pixel dimensions. Our social media presets handle both automatically - they crop to correct ratio then resize to platform dimensions.
Never! All image resizing happens entirely in your browser using HTML5 Canvas API. Your photos never upload to any server - no network requests are made with your image data. This makes it completely safe for personal photos, client photography work, confidential business images, or any sensitive content. The tool works offline once loaded. Photos are processed locally, resized images are generated in browser memory, and downloads are created client-side. Your images remain 100% private and secure on your device only. No storage, no servers, no privacy concerns.
Need a Custom Website Built?
While you use our free tools, let us build your professional website. Fast, affordable, and hassle-free.